**Runbook: Flaky integration tests — Coinlark payments service.** If the Coinlark pipeline fails on the settlement suite, first rerun only the failed shard; roughly half the failures are timing-related and pass on retry. Persistent failures usually trace to the Mockvault sandbox resetting mid-run, which drops auth tokens. Do not mark tests as skipped without filing a ticket, since the Tallyworks team tracks flake rates weekly. Known flaky cases, their owners, and quarantine procedure are listed on the page below.

wiki page, hahif-hahif: https://argocd.kelvisys.corp/browse/board/settings/pages/1442e0b1065d83f1

Hey, welcome aboard! Quick handover on Feedwright, our podcast feed validator. It checks RSS enclosures, episode GUIDs, and artwork dimensions. Cron runs hourly; failures land in the triage queue. The XML namespace checks are flaky — known issue, don't panic. Docs live in the team wiki. If you get stuck, the current owner of Feedwright is:

named custodian: Brivan Eliath Quenox Frador

If the underlying comparator were unstable, secondary sort keys would silently scramble rows that tie on the primary key, producing reports that differ between runs with identical data. We pin a stable merge sort for this reason, and any replacement must preserve that guarantee. Before touching the sort pipeline during an incident, review the invariants document, which explains the tie-breaking contract in full. It is maintained on the internal page below.

operations page: https://jenkins.zemvarcloud.local/job/merge_requests/repo/build/73930b4b30f0a8ed

MEETING NOTES — Payroll Logistics, Brindle & Voss Distribution

The Aldercourt satellite site still has no working printer, so payslips for that crew will continue to be printed centrally and sent out in a sealed envelope each pay Friday. The shift lead signs the transit log on receipt and distributes slips by hand. The confidential instruction for the courier hand-over is set out below.

courier memo of tawep-tajep: the quenius ulaiel courier leaves the fenir ledger at gate 9128 under passcode 527513